David Macilwain It has just been announced that Facebook is banning some “dangerous people” from its platforms, particularly those promoting and allowing “hate speech” of various colours, but also...
Max Parry Ever since the news broke on March 15 of two consecutive mass shootings at the Al Noor Mosque and Linwood Islamic Centre in Christchurch, New Zealand, corporate...
No matter the source of the violence, no matter the politics or casualties or the location, it seems the reaction of governments in the face of "terrorism" is virtually...